Class: Shrub.   (Series: Parkland Series Collection)   
Bloom: Yellow blend.  Flowers dark orange with yellow base opening to orange with bright yellow.  Strong, opinions vary fragrance.  12 petals.  Average diameter 3".  Medium, semi-double (9-16 petals), cluster-flowered, in small clusters bloom form.  Blooms in flushes throughout the season.   
Habit: Medium, spreading, upright.  Glossy, dark green foliage.  
 Height: 28" (70cm).
 
Growing: USDA zone 3b and warmer.  Can be used for beds and borders, container rose, cut flower or garden.  Very hardy.  Disease susceptibility: susceptible to blackspot .   
Patents: United States - Patent No: PP 13,969  on  15 Jul 2003   VIEW USPTO PATENT Application No: 09/826,366  on  5 Apr 2001 
Notes: The first hardy yellow rose in the Canadian series. Lineage supplied by Larry Dyck, Morden Station. |
